Languages & Technology

Languages & Technology
37 articles
Updated 8th Jul 2023

Unlock the power of coding languages and cutting-edge technologies. Stay ahead in the dynamic tech landscape with our expert insights and hands-on tips for mastering the latest tools.

Why Is JavaScript Bad? Debunking Misconceptions About This Popular Programming Language Languages & Technology

Why Is JavaScript Bad? Debunking Misconceptions About This Popular Programming Language

In the world of programming, JavaScript has garnered a mixed bag of reactions. For some, it's the essential cog in the wheel of web development, but for others, it's a pain point riddled with flaws that can't be overlooked. One could ask, why is JavaScript hated even as it powers the dynamic features we relish on websites? That's what we aim to uncover. Here are some reasons why JavaScript may be disliked by a chunk of developers. First off, code, when written poorly in JavaScript, can...

Is Linux Faster Than Windows? Unveiling the Hidden Truth Behind Operating Systems Languages & Technology

Is Linux Faster Than Windows? Unveiling the Hidden Truth Behind Operating Systems

You've probably heard it before: Linux is faster than Windows. But what's the real story behind the speed difference? Is it actually true that Linux outperforms Windows, or is it something Linux enthusiasts just like to claim? Before we delve into the depths of this topic, it's crucial to understand that speed in an operating system can mean many things, including faster boot times, quicker file transfers, or more efficient resource usage. When pitting Linux against Windows, these...

Webflow vs React - A Comprehensive Comparison for Your Projects Languages & Technology

Webflow vs React - A Comprehensive Comparison for Your Projects

When it comes to website design and development, you'll likely encounter the names Webflow and React. But it's essential to understand the fundamental differences between these two tools before choosing one for your project. Webflow is a robust web design platform, while React is a programming library used for building user interfaces in web applications. Webflow offers you a powerful, visual way to craft websites without necessarily writing code. It combines a user-friendly interface with...

Does Figma Automatically Save? Uncovering the Truth Languages & Technology

Does Figma Automatically Save? Uncovering the Truth

Designing with Figma can be an enjoyable and efficient experience, especially when you don't have to worry about losing your work. If you've ever wondered whether Figma automatically saves your progress, you're in luck. Figma does, indeed, save your work automatically. No more stressing about hitting Ctrl+S or having your computer crash in the middle of your design flow. I remember when I first started using Figma; I was so used to manually saving my projects in other design...

What Language Is Photoshop Written In - Behind the Code Languages & Technology

What Language Is Photoshop Written In - Behind the Code

When discussing the creation of Adobe Photoshop, one of the popular image editing and graphic design software, it's important to consider the language it has been written in. Knowing the programming language can provide valuable insights into the software's functionality and capabilities. So, what language is Photoshop written in? Primarily, Photoshop is written in C++, a widely-used programming language that offers a balanced mix of high performance and ease of development. This choice has...

Can You Have Multiple Gitignore Files? Exploring Your Options Languages & Technology

Can You Have Multiple Gitignore Files? Exploring Your Options

When it comes to managing a git repository, one essential file is the . gitignore. This file makes it easy to exclude unneeded files and directories from the git version control system, keeping your repository clean and organized. But can you have multiple gitignore files within a single repository? Yes, you can have multiple . gitignore files. This feature is useful for handling complex projects with various components or submodules. In a large project with multiple subdirectories, you can...

Is Java Front End or Backend? Clarifying the Difference Languages & Technology

Is Java Front End or Backend? Clarifying the Difference

When it comes to web development, Java can be utilized as both a front-end and back-end language. However, you might be curious, can Java truly be used effectively as a front-end language? While Java is not traditionally known for front-end development, it can still serve this purpose in specific scenarios. The reasons why Java is a better option for the back-end are numerous. For one, Java is a powerful and versatile language that offers robust performance and stability. Additionally, its...

Is Mac Linux? Exploring the Key Differences and Similarities Languages & Technology

Is Mac Linux? Exploring the Key Differences and Similarities

You've probably wondered at some point, is Mac Linux or Unix? Interestingly, macOS, the operating system that runs on Apple's Mac computers, is neither a strict Linux-based nor a Unix-only operating system. Instead, it's a hybrid that has its roots in Unix, with some similarities to Linux systems. At its core, macOS is actually based on BSD (Berkeley Software Distribution), which is a version of Unix. That's why when you look at Mac's underlying architecture, you'll notice many Unix features....

Is JavaScript Hard to Learn? Debunking Myths and Tips for Success Languages & Technology

Is JavaScript Hard to Learn? Debunking Myths and Tips for Success

Is JavaScript hard to learn? This is a common question for beginners who are considering diving into programming. First off, it's essential to understand that every person's learning ability differs, which means your experience with JavaScript may not be the same as someone else's. However, based on the experience of many developers, JavaScript can be considered relatively easy to learn compared to other programming languages. To give you an idea, I remember when I first started learning...

Is HTML a Programming Language? Unraveling the Mystery Languages & Technology

Is HTML a Programming Language? Unraveling the Mystery

In the world of web development, HTML (HyperText Markup Language) is an essential tool for constructing websites from the ground up. But is HTML truly considered a programming language? This is a common question among both beginner and experienced developers, and delving into the technical classifications will help clarify this inquiry. First and foremost, it's important to understand that programming languages are distinct from markup languages. Programming languages consist of a set of...

Best Way to Learn TypeScript - Simplify Your Journey Languages & Technology

Best Way to Learn TypeScript - Simplify Your Journey

So you're eager to improve your TypeScript skills? That's fantastic! As the use of TypeScript continues to grow, learning how to use it effectively has become increasingly important for modern web developers. Whether you're a seasoned programmer or just starting out, this article will help you find the best way to learn TypeScript. Everyone has their own learning style, so it's important to find a method that works for you. Here's a personal anecdote: When I first began learning TypeScript, I...

Is React Hard to Learn? Your Guide to Mastering It Fast Languages & Technology

Is React Hard to Learn? Your Guide to Mastering It Fast

Learning a new technology can seem like a daunting task, especially when it's as popular and widely used as React. Is React hard to learn? The answer depends on your current level of programming experience, your familiarity with JavaScript, and your personal learning style. We'll break down the factors that can make learning React easier or more challenging, and share a personal anecdote that sheds some light on the process. Firstly, it's important to note that React is a powerful JavaScript...